Belarus welcomes Lithuania’s decision to tighten border controls
MINSK, 28 October (BelTA) – The State Border Committee of Belarus supports the decision of Lithuania to tighten controls on the state border due to increased smuggling activity, BelTA learned from spokesman for the Belarusian border agency Alexander Tishchenko.
“This is a normal practice to ensure the security of the state in every country. Similar actions have been conducted by Belarus. Belarus takes every effort to prevent smuggling and other offences on the state border,” said Alexander Tishchenko.
